Laurie Hochberg

CFO at Encentiv Energy

Laurie Hochberg has had a long and varied career in finance, beginning in 1986 as an Audit Staff Accountant at Grant Thornton LLP. Laurie then moved to J.J. Gumberg Company as an Assistant Controller in 1988, followed by a position as Controller and then Assistant Controller at Suprex Corporation from 1989 to 1994. During this time, they successfully implemented Great Plains accounting package, changing from Solomon accounting package. In 2005, they became Controller at Multimodal Technologies Inc., where they created all financial systems from the "ground up" and developed an initial billing system based upon per minute of audio processed. In 2009, they were promoted to CFO, where they worked closely with the founders of the closely held private company regarding all growth and or exit strategy scenarios. This resulted in the sale of the company in 2011 for $130 million. Laurie then became Transitional CFO M*Modal Tech division at M*Modal Inc. from 2011 to 2014, where they were directly responsible for integration of (legacy) M*Modal Tech into the parent company. In 2014, they moved to Rhiza as a Director of Finance, tasked with building on previous experiences to help Rhiza obtain rapid growth as a SaaS company. Finally, they are currently CFO of Encentiv Energy, where they are building infrastructure for growth for a newly funded SaaS company, creating financial reporting and strategic planning models, and developing key metrics to monitor and provide meaningful information. Laurie is also evaluating M&A opportunities and managing HR, facilities, and helping to create an exciting, challenging, and fulfilling company culture.

Laurie Hochberg obtained a Bachelor of Science (B.S.) in Accounting from PennWest Clarion between 1982 and 1986.
